Safety of Measles-Mumps-Rubella booster vaccination in patients with juvenile idiopathic arthritis: A long-term follow-up study
CONCLUSION: MMR booster vaccination was safe and did not worsen disease activity during long-term follow-up in a large cohort of JIA patients being treated with both csDMARDs and biological DMARDs.PMID:37032229 | DOI:10.1016/j.vaccine.2023.03.074
